7月26日,第19届中美碳联盟年会在南京信息工程大学顺利召开。年会主题围绕“气候与环境变化下的陆地碳水循环”,充分交流在生态系统协同观测、数据融合、模型模拟、圈层交叉和服务功能等方向的重要成果。
On July 26th, the 19th US-China Carbon Consortium Annual Conference was successfully held at Nanjing University of Information Science and Technology. The conference focused on the theme "Terrestrial Carbon-Water Cycle under Climate and Environmental Changes" and facilitated extensive exchanges on significant achievements in ecosystem collaborative observation, data fusion, model simulation, cross-disciplinary interactions, and service functionalities.
宁波海尔欣光电科技有限公司受邀参加专题研讨。7月26日下午,海尔欣总经理王胤博士针对公司品牌“昕甬智测”HT8800系列便携式高精度温室气体分析仪,分享题为A portable, high-precision optical analyzer based on hybrid laser absorption cell for simultaneous measurements of N2O, CH4 and CO2 fluxes from soils(基于混合激光吸收池的便携式高精度光学分析仪,可同时测量土壤中的N2O、CH4和CO2通量)的案例应用与相关成果。该项目由清华大学深圳国际研究生院、宁波海尔欣光电科技有限公司、宁波诺丁汉大学联合研究。相关成果也在EGU2023中进行口头论述。
HealthyPhoton Technology Co., Ltd. was invited to participate in a special seminar. On the afternoon of June 14th, Dr. Wang Yin, the General Manager of HealthyPhoton, presented a case study and relevant achievements on HT8800 series all-in-one multi-component portable GHG analyzer. The presentation is titled "A portable, high-precision optical analyzer based on hybrid laser absorption cell for simultaneous measurements of N2O, CH4, and CO2 fluxes from soils." This project is a joint research effort by Tsinghua University -SIGS, HealthyPhoton Technology Co., Ltd., and the University of Nottingham Ningbo China. The related achievements will also be orally presented at EGU2023.
